Feb 28, 2016 The simplest form of secondary crushing stage involves a single crusher, taking its feed by gravity flow direct from the primary with no interposed scalping separation. This is tantamount to making the over-all reduction in one machine, except of course that there will always be a certain amount of surge capacity between the two crushers.

Aug 01, 2019 In the mining industry, the most common crusher types are jaw crusher and cone crusher. Jaw crusher is usually used for primary crushing, and cone crusher is used for secondary crushing. The material of crusher plays an important role in its working efficiency and service life. However, the regular operation and maintenance are important, too.
Cone crushers are commonly used for secondary crushing (although impact crushers are sometimes used), which typically reduces material to about 2.5 to 10 centimeters (1 to 4 inches). The material (throughs) from the second level of the screen bypasses the secondary crusher because it is sufficiently small for the last crushing step.
